Choosing between the Apple MacBook Pro 14 (2021) and the Dell Alienware m17 R5 depends on your needs. The MacBook Pro offers better portability, higher screen quality, and excellent build quality and is ideal for general use, with good performance for 3D and engineering tasks, but at a higher price. The Alienware m17, on the other hand, is a great choice for gaming and offers superior performance for 3D and machine learning applications and engineering tasks at a lower price, but is heavier and not as portable, with a lower screen resolution and shorter battery life. The Apple MacBook Pro 14 (2021) is very good for general use, while the Dell Alienware m17 R5 is good.
The Apple MacBook Pro 14 (2021) offers excellent portability and a high-quality Mini LED screen suitable for a range of tasks with its efficient CPU and long battery life, making it very good for general use. On the other hand, the Dell Alienware m17 R5, while having a larger screen and more storage, is less portable due to its size and weight, and it has a shorter battery life, yet it provides ample power for demanding applications, positioning it as a good option for general use as well.

The Dell Alienware m17 R5 is good for gaming and AI, while the Apple MacBook Pro 14 (2021) is only fair.
The Apple MacBook Pro 14, with its Apple M1 Pro integrated GPU, is good for 3D tasks and offers a Mini LED screen with a high refresh rate and excellent screen quality, while the Dell Alienware m17 R5 comes with a high-performance Nvidia RTX 3060 dedicated GPU and a much higher refresh rate, which coupled with a larger screen, benefits gaming but at the cost of macOS compatibility for many popular games.

The Apple MacBook Pro 14 has a better screen than the Dell Alienware m17 R5 for general use, engineering and design, software development, and content creation.
The Apple MacBook Pro 14 boasts a high-resolution display with vibrant colors and excellent brightness, making it ideal for general use and tasks requiring color accuracy, like engineering and design. Conversely, its lower refresh rate compared to some gaming-oriented laptops means it's less suitable for 3D applications where smooth motion is key. The Dell Alienware m17 R5, while offering a decent screen for everyday and professional tasks, falls short for gaming and 3D due to its subpar refresh rate, despite having reasonable resolution and panel quality.

"In the Apple MacBook Pro 14 2023, the M2 Pro is slowed down. From the improved 5nm process, the new M2 Pro is a very solid upgrade. Graphics performance has increased by about 25% in tandem with a clear improvement in efficiency. The processor has also seen a performance leap of up to 20%, but this is accompanied by an increase in consumption of up to 25%. Fundamentally, Apple its maintaining its advantage over AMD and Intel, particularly in optimized applications where the results are very good in view of the comparatively low power consumption."
"Overall, the all-AMD system in the Alienware m17 R5 is impressive, especially the graphics performance. However, various driver issues and unnecessary inconsistencies prevent us from truly enjoying such a potent gaming machine. In addition to strong 3D performance, we particularly like the build quality, the fairly bright UHD display with high color space coverage, and the fact that the gamer is often quiet when not under load and also rather quieter than some competitors under load."

About Apple
Apple, an American technology company, is one of the world’s largest company in terms of market capitalization. Their MacBook laptops feature a slim, minimalistic design, class-leading battery life, and premium display and speaker quality. In 2020 Apple switched from using Intel processors to their own silicon chips which have excellent performance and efficiency. The macOS operating system is the second most widely used OS, after Windows.
About Dell
Dell is a highly recognizable American technology company, and is one of the largest personal computer vendor by market share. Their laptops are very popular for both personal and professional use, and they also own the Alienware brand which makes mid to high end gaming laptops. Their premium XPS range of laptops offer great build quality and portability, while Latitude and Precision laptops are known for reliability, repairability and performance for business users.
